Bookkeepers provide priceless services to any business, but how much does it really cost your company to add another employee to the team? When you hire a traditional, in-office bookkeeper, you don't just commit to paying a base salary. There are other expenses associated with hiring an employee as well. You'll also pay for employee taxes, benefits, time off, increased overhead, and other costs. These expenses can quickly add up to more than you anticipated.

Typical costs of hiring a traditional, in-office bookkeeper:

Expenses Annual Cost — Part Time (20 hrs/week)
Base salary ($14.75/hour) $15,000
Benefits (15% of salary) $2,250
Payment for sick days, holidays, etc. $1,950
Payroll taxes $1,800
Administrative costs $1,350
Supplies and equipment $3,900
Rental of space for in-office employee $2,250
Annual Total $28,500
